While a Superstore employee may handle various roles including stocking and customer service, a Cashier primarily focuses on processing transactions at checkout. Both roles are essential in retail environments, but Superstore positions often require broader responsibilities and experience, whereas Cashiers specialize in payment processing and customer interaction at the point of sale.
